BYK-021 is a VOC-free, silicone-containing defoamer for aqueous high-gloss emulsion systems, dispersion adhesives, printing inks, and overprint varnishes. It is particularly suitable for high-gloss and satin-gloss systems and for airless applications.

Coatings Industry
Special Features and Benefits
BYK-021 is particularly suitable for pigmented high gloss emulsion systems based on styrene acrylate, acrylate or acrylate/polyurethane with a pigment volume concentration of 18-25. The additive defoams particularly high-gloss and satin-gloss systems, even in airless application.
Recommended Levels
0.1-0.8% additive (as supplied) based upon total formulation.
The above recommended levels can be used for orientation. Optimal levels are determined through a series of laboratory tests.
Incorporation and Processing Instructions
Due to its high incompatibility, the defoamer must be incorporated at high shear forces to ensure a good distribution. Otherwise defects may occur in the system.

Composition Data

Mixture of foam-destroying polysiloxanes and hydrophobic solids in polyglycol.
